bottom-dwelling

English

Adjective

bottom-dwelling (not comparable)

  1. (Of an aquatic organism) living on or near the bed of the sea, a lake, or other body of water.
  2. (sports, humorous) (Of a team or competitor) spending a long time in the lowest ranks of the competition ladder.
